WiFi Chat v0.9 Beta (NDS Application)
Bafio has once more updated his WiFi chat application for the Nintendo DS. Changes:* New default skin, designed by Rat (Ben) of Drunken Coders* New keyboard with support for all the keys, shift and caps.* Multiple messages view (press X to change from 1 message to 4 messages view)* Menus (back to bootloader, turn off the ds...)* Settings (change nickname)* Changable font for the drawings* Changable skins (simple JPG images, located in the /skins folder)http://bafio.drunkencoders.com/ Read more about WiFi Chat v0.9 Beta (NDS Application)

DSLua v0.2 Preview (NDS misc)
Lua for the Nintendo DS has been updated. Lua is a simple basic like scripting language which is available for many platforms.Removed the need to press START after each script executes (replaced with a short delay)Integrated with Chishm's FAT driver (2006-03-03), better SD read supportBy turning off CF, DSLua now runs on DeSmuME 0.3.3GBFS is now accessible from the scriptBetter error reporting when a script encounter an errorFixed text positions when user alternates between top and bottom screen using print()http://www.dslua.com/ Read more about DSLua v0.2 Preview (NDS misc)
DSMerlin v0.2 (NDS Misc)
DSmerlin has been updated. It is a port of the open source XMerlin handwriting recognition project for the Nintendo DS. Changes:To improve recognition accuracy, multiple gestures for each character have been removed. There is now only 1 way to draw each character. Gestures also more closely match the Graffiti style.Numeric characters 0-9 are now recognized.Gestures have been added for space, backspace and return.http://ds.crmx.us/dsmerlin/index.html Read more about DSMerlin v0.2 (NDS Misc)
